Vue转场效果常见问题解决方案-的转场效果依赖于-如果问题依旧可以查阅更多文档或社区资源寻求帮助

Vue转场效果常见问题及解决方案


一、缺少CSS过渡效果代码

Vue的转场效果依赖于CSS过渡。如果CSS中缺少相关代码,转场效果就不会出现。记得在你的CSS文件里定义那些过渡类。

二、未正确使用组件

Vue提供了专门的组件来实现转场效果。确保你正确使用了这个组件,并且把需要转场的元素包裹在对应的标签内。

三、未绑定过渡名称

在使用组件时,你需要通过属性来定义过渡的名称,这样Vue才能找到并应用对应的CSS类。

四、版本更新引起的API变化

Vue版本更新可能会导致API变化,转场效果的实现方式也可能随之改变。查看最新的官方文档,了解当前版本的最佳实践。

五、未正确引用Vue库

如果Vue库没有被正确引用,转场效果可能无法正常工作。确保你使用的是正确的Vue版本,并且正确地引用了Vue库。

总结和建议

Vue转场效果可能因为以下原因不工作:缺少CSS过渡代码、未正确使用组件、未绑定过渡名称、版本更新引起的API变化或未正确引用Vue库。

为了解决问题,你可以:

如果问题依旧,可以查阅更多官方文档或社区资源寻求帮助。

相关问答FAQs

Q: 为什么Vue没有转场了?

A: Vue为了提升性能和减少代码冗余,对转场功能进行了优化和改进。

Vue 3.0引入了Composition API和虚拟DOM算法的改进,开发者可以通过自定义方式实现转场效果,并获得更好的性能和代码可维护性。

Q: 如何在Vue中实现转场效果?

A: 尽管Vue 3.0没有内置的转场功能,你可以通过使用CSS动画或第三方库来实现转场效果。例如,使用CSS动画来定义过渡效果,或使用第三方库提供更丰富的效果。

Q: 为什么Vue改进了转场功能?

A: Vue改进转场功能是为了提升性能、减少代码冗余,并提供更灵活的开发方式。通过Composition API和改进的虚拟DOM算法,开发者可以实现自定义的转场效果,并获得更好的性能和代码可维护性。